Which size entrance hole should I choose?

This product includes two entrance hole options, allowing you to choose the right box for the birds in your garden:

  • 26mm entrance hole– Ideal for Blue Tits, with occasional use by Coal and Marsh Tits
  • 32mm entrance hole – Suitable for a wider range of species including Great Tits, Blue Tits, House Sparrows, Tree Sparrows, Nuthatches, Redstarts and Pied Flycatchers

Both variants share the same premium construction and dimensions.

Siting and Positioning:
Suitable mounting surfaces:

  • Trees
  • Walls
  • Sheds
  • Fence posts

Recommended height: 1.5–2.5 metres (5–8 feet)

Recommended orientation: North, North-East

Avoid:
Direct midday sun
Prevailing wind

Can be installed year-round
(Late winter / early spring ideal for breeding season)

Frequently Asked Questions

Does the CedarPlus Bird Nest Box need treating or painting?

No. The British cedar wood used is a superior, naturally durable and weather-resistant material. It should never be painted or treated, as this can harm birds and reduce breathability.

When is the best time to put the nest box up?

Ideally in late winter or early spring, but nest boxes can be installed at any time of year. Birds may also use them for overnight roosting outside the breeding season.

Is this nest box suitable for British garden birds?

Yes. The Ark CedarPlus™ Hole Nest Box is specifically designed for native British species, with entrance hole sizes matched to common garden birds.

What birds will use the 26mm and 32mm nest box entrance holes?

- 26mm hole: Blue Tits primarily, with occasional Coal and Marsh Tits
- 32mm: Great Tits, Blue Tits, House Sparrows, Tree Sparrows, Nuthatches, Redstarts and Pied Flycatchers
